Technical Features of Hardware Cloth
Hardware cloth is characterized by its mesh size, wire diameter, and material composition. Below is a comparison table highlighting the key technical features of hardware cloth.
Feature | Description |
---|---|
Material | Stainless steel, galvanized steel, PVC coated, etc. |
Mesh Size | Ranges from 1×1 inch to 500×500 mesh. |
Wire Diameter | Varies from 0.025 mm to 2.03 mm (0.001 inch to 0.08 inch). |
Aperture Size | Aperture can range from 0.0254 mm to 23.37 mm (0.001 inch to 0.92 inch). |
Finish | Galvanized, PVC coated, or plain. |
Standard Width | Typically less than 2000 mm. |
Standard Length | Available in rolls or cut to size. |
Types of Hardware Cloth
Hardware cloth comes in various types, each suited for specific applications. The following table outlines the different types of hardware cloth and their characteristics.
Type | Description |
---|---|
Galvanized Hardware Cloth | Coated with zinc for corrosion resistance; ideal for outdoor use. |
Stainless Steel Hardware Cloth | Offers superior strength and corrosion resistance; used in harsh environments. |
PVC Coated Hardware Cloth | Provides additional protection against rust and UV rays; available in various colors. |
Welded Wire Mesh | Made from welded wires; offers high strength and stability. |
Crimped Wire Mesh | Features crimped wires for added strength; commonly used in industrial applications. |
Applications of Hardware Cloth
Hardware cloth is widely used in various industries and applications. Here are some common uses:
- Fencing: Hardware cloth is often used for animal enclosures and garden fencing due to its durability and strength.
- Screening: It serves as a screening material for windows and doors, providing protection against insects while allowing airflow.
- Construction: Used in construction for reinforcing concrete and as a support for plaster and stucco.
- Gardening: Ideal for creating plant supports, trellises, and protective barriers against pests.
- Industrial Uses: Employed in various industrial applications, including filtration, separation, and as machine guards.
